Cayce Clerk United States of America, Plaintiff—Appellee, versus Christian Christopher Rodriguez-Lopez, Defendant—Appellant. ______________________________ Appeal from the United States District Court for the Southern District of Texas USDC No. 7:24-CR-622-1 ______________________________ Before Stewart, Graves, and Oldham, Circuit Judges.
Per Curiam: * The Federal Public Defender appointed to represent Christian Christopher Rodriguez-Lopez has moved for leave to withdraw and has filed a brief in accordance with Anders v. California, 386 U.S. 738 (1967), and United States v. Flores, 632 F.3d 229 (5th Cir. 2011). Rodriguez-Lopez has not filed a response. We have reviewed counsel’s brief and the relevant _____________________ * This opinion is not designated for publication. See 5th Cir. R. 47.5.
Case: 25-40362 Document: 52-1 Page: 2 Date Filed: 05/08/2026
No. 25-40362 portions of the record reflected therein. It is dispositive that the Government has declined to waive the untimeliness of the appeal. See United States v. Pesina-Rodriguez, 825 F.3d 787, 788 (5th Cir. 2016). Accordingly, counsel’s motion for leave to withdraw is GRANTED, counsel is excused from further responsibilities herein, and the appeal is DISMISSED. See 5th Cir. R. 42.2.
